Description

It has been there for about six weeks. I sent an email to the MTA on February 4th. My email to them and their response is copied below.

We regret if you experienced difficulty due to the conditions you reported.

Please be assured that customer safety and comfort are New York City Transit’s highest priorities. All stations are scheduled to be cleaned and disinfected, and station cleaners are responsible for removing litter, emptying trash receptacles, and disinfecting unsanitary areas upon detection. Stations are also routinely inspected and baited for rodents as necessary. In addition, some of our stations are hose-washed with high-pressurized hot water.

In response to your e-mail, we will continue to inspect all stations and adjust cleaning coverage as necessary to ensure a proper environment for our customers.
